Project # 4660-6X4256
FISCAL IMPACT:
The project will be funded by 97% American Recovery Reinvestment Act funds and 3%
East Contra Costa Regional Fee and Financing Funds.

The Board of Supervisors having determined that the project is exempt from the California
Environmental Quality Act as a Class 1C Categorical Exemption, and a Notice of
Exemption having been filed with the County Clerk on May 19, 2010.
The DBE Liaison Officer (DBELO) has reported that Teichert attained 7.27% Underutilized
Disadvantaged Business Enterprise (UDBE) participation, which exceeds the 4.24% UDBE
goal for this project and complies with the requirements of the County’s Disadvantaged
Business Enterprise (DBE) Program for federally-funded projects.
The bidder listed first above, Teichert, submitted the lowest responsive and responsible bid,
which is $ 4,668.56 less than the next lowest bid.
As required by the project specifications, Teichert has executed a Project Labor Agreement
(PLA) for this project, under which Teichert and its subcontractors will utilize the local
union hiring hall (Contra Costa County Building and Construction Trades Council) for the
labor required for this project.
The Director of Public Works recommends that the bid submitted by Teichert is the lowest
responsive and responsible bid, and this Board concurs and so finds.
CONSEQUENCE OF NEGATIVE ACTION:
The State Route 4 Bypass Segment 3 Rubberized Hot Mix Asphalt Overlay project would
not be built and federal ARRA funding would potentially be lost.
